Original Description
Albrecht Dürer’s The Visitation (Bartsch Wc 84) is a masterful engraving that captures the biblical moment when the Virgin Mary visits her cousin Elizabeth, both women miraculously pregnant. The composition radiates a tender, almost ethereal intimacy, with delicate cross-hatching accentuating the folds of their garments and the emotional depth of their embrace. Dürer’s Northern Renaissance precision shines through in the intricate details—the architectural backdrop, the expressive faces, and the symbolic gestures—infusing the scene with both realism and spiritual gravity. Created around 1503–1505, this work exemplifies Dürer’s mastery of line and his ability to blend Gothic sensibilities with emerging Renaissance ideals. It holds a pivotal place in art history as one of the finest examples of early printmaking, showcasing how Dürer elevated engraving to the level of high art. The piece is celebrated for its technical brilliance and its capacity to convey profound human emotion within a religious narrative.
